According to me, "Support Anti Blast" refers to defense against zero-day attacks. As for Sangfor HCI, it helps to swiftly and efficiently identify zero-day threats by supporting them with a range of security features and capabilities, such as Micro-segmentation, built-in IDS/IPS, Sandboxing, Patch management, and interaction with SIEM.
